An unmissable opportunity to experience a moment of intense emotion and reflection: Sunday 13 April at 19.00, the Basilica SS. of the Immaculate Conception of Catanzaro will host “meditating the passion on the notes of hope”, an event that unites music, spirituality and meditation in a unique experience.

The protagonist of the evening will be the “San Vitaliano” polyphonic choir, directed by the Maestro Stefano Scozzafavawhich will accompany the public on a deeply suggestive sound journey, together with an orchestral ensemble formed by high professional profile musicians.

The evening will be enriched by the interventions of Don Sergio IacopettaRector of the basilica, and of the actress Romina Mazzaending with the words of the archbishop Msgr. Claudio Maniago. To present the event will be Mario Sei.

Posted in the concert season Agimus 2024-2025 and sponsored free of charge by the Municipality of Catanzaro, the appointment represents a precious opportunity to be inspired by the beauty of sacred music and the universal message of hope.

An invitation open to all citizens to rediscover, through harmonies and words, the profound meaning of passion.
